Output 45f2a3613b2ed4e2c666cdde655707b589b2d9c3d028f5764e56fc54ee31344a:0

value
8044952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f33b15889f0e2f6013c8103de88dd4223f092c92 OP_EQUAL
address
3Ps6uPrfRQTURRPMRACHG5Pj5LRHfNGmkE
transaction
45f2a3613b2ed4e2c666cdde655707b589b2d9c3d028f5764e56fc54ee31344a
confirmations
266758
spent
true